Matt Nathanson (born 28 March 1973 in Lexington, Massachusetts) is a singer-songwriter whose work is a blend of folk and rock music. In addition to singing, he plays acoustic guitar (usually a twelve-string), and has played both solo and with a full band. Wikipedia
